[Bologna, Italy] Encountering Morandi

#FreeHotelStay When we were talking about which Italian painter was my favorite in my Italian class, I said that I liked Giorgio Morandi, but my young teacher didn't know who he was. He never left the city of Bologna where he was born and raised, and continued to paint pictures using bottles, vases, and cans that actually surrounded him as motifs, and he is now one of the most important painters in the history of 20th century Italian art. Why were you attracted to him? In Japan, where daily life seems to be a repetition of the same thing, when I saw his art book, I was surprised to see that he continued to paint bottles that all look the same, but in fact have slightly different nuances. Then, more and more, his paintings blended with the surroundings, playing the time and presence of things that are extremely quiet, but still firmly alive. Morandi's paintings make us realize that the days that seem the same are actually a series of irreplaceable days. "All I want is peace and quiet," said Morandi. As expected, standing in front of his paintings was refreshing. I will always love what I love. If you go to Bologna, you can always meet Morandi. Museo Morandi Via Don Minzoni, 14 051 6496611 Tuesday, Wednesday, Friday 12:00-18:00 Thursday, Saturday, Sunday, and public holidays 12:00-20:00 Closed on Mondays Casa Mirandi Via Fondazza 36 40125 Bologna 051 300150 Reservations are required, and the museum is not always open, so we recommend that you check the opening hours before visiting.
